Why Calculating Aquarium Capacity Matters
Lots of novices make the mistake of counting on the maker's nominal size (e.g., buying a "50-gallon tank" and assuming it holds 50 gallons of water). In truth, calculating the precise capability is crucial for a number of reasons:
- Stocking Limits: The traditional "one inch of fish per gallon" rule depends on accurate volume. Overstocking leads to bad water quality and worried fish.
- Medication Dosing: Under-dosing medication will fail to treat illness, while over-dosing can be toxic and deadly to aquatic life.
- Water Treatments: Dechlorinators, fertilizers, and pH adjusters need to be determined versus the precise volume of water in the system.
- Devices Sizing: Heaters and filters are ranked by gallon capacity. An inaccurate calculation can result in insufficient filtration or temperature level changes.
The Standard Formulas for Tank Shapes
A lot of Fish Tank Weight Calculator tanks are geometric shapes. By determining the inside dimensions of the tank (length, width, and height) in inches, fish keepers can calculate the volume in cubic inches and convert it into gallons or liters.
1. Rectangle-shaped Aquariums
The most typical tank shape is the rectangular prism.
- Formula: ₤ text Volume (gallons) = frac text Length times text Width times text Height 231 ₤
- Why 231? There are 231 cubic inches in a basic U.S. liquid gallon.
2. Round Aquariums
Column or round tanks are popular for their 360-degree viewing angles, but their volume requires the formula for the volume of a cylinder.
- Formula: ₤ text Volume (gallons) = frac pi times r ^ 2 times text Height 231 ₤
- ( Note: ₤ r ₤ is the radius, which is half of the cylinder's size).
3. Bow-Front Aquariums
Bow-front tanks have a curved front glass that increases the volume a little compared to a basic rectangle-shaped tank of the same footprint.
- Formula: ₤ text Volume (gallons) = frac ( text Flat Width + text Max Width) div 2 times text Length times text Height 231 ₤

One of the most typical risks in the Aquarium Water Calculator pastime is puzzling tank capability with real water volume.
When a tank is filled, numerous components use up physical area inside the glass, displacing water. Therefore, a tank ranked for 50 gallons will seldom hold a complete 50 gallons of water.
Aspects That Reduce Actual Water Volume:
- Substrate: Gravel, sand, and aqusoil layers can use up anywhere from 5% to 15% of the overall Tank Calculator Fish volume.
- Hardscape: Large rocks, driftwood, and ceramic decors displace substantial quantities of water.
- Devices: Internal filters, heating units, and air stones reduce the liquid capability.
- Unfavorable Space: Most hobbyists do not fill their tanks to the outright brim; a standard safety margin leaves about 1 to 2 inches of area at the top.
As a general guideline, subtract 10% to 15% from the calculated geometric volume to discover the real water volume of a heavily decorated tank.
Step-by-Step Guide to Calculating Actual Water Volume
For those who desire to be 100% accurate, follow this step-by-step method throughout the preliminary fill-up:
- Measure the Empty Tank: Measure the interior length, width, and height in inches and use the formula to discover the maximum possible capacity.
- Represent the Substrate and Hardscape: Once the substrate and decorations remain in location, determine the height of the water line from the bottom of the tank (rather than the overall height of the glass).
- Utilize the Water Line Calculation: Recalculate utilizing the water height rather of the glass height:₤ ₤ text Actual Volume = frac text Length times text Width times text Water Height 231 ₤ ₤
- The Bucket Method (Alternative): For irregularly shaped tanks, the most accurate approach is to fill the tank using a marked container (like a 1-gallon or 5-gallon container), keeping a stringent count of the number of gallons are poured in until it reaches the preferred level.
Necessary Tips for Success
To ensure precision and security when handling aquarium capacities, keep these best practices in mind:
- Always step from the within: Measuring the outside of the glass consists of the density of the glass panels, which can toss off the computation by a gallon or more on larger tanks.
- Convert Metric easily: If operating in centimeters, use the metric formula (₤ text Length times text Width times text Height in cm div 1000 = text Liters ₤). To transform liters to U.S. gallons, divide the overall liters by 3.785.
- Never max out stocking limitations: Always base your stocking choices on the lower end of your actual water volume estimation to offer a buffer for your fish.
